How to Plan Accessible Upgrades That Work

A ramp added after the paving is complete, a compliant doorway that leads to an inaccessible reception counter, or an accessible toilet used for storage are familiar signs of accessibility being treated as a late-stage item. The cost is not only financial. Poorly coordinated upgrades can limit participation, delay approvals and leave asset owners exposed to avoidable complaints and rectification work. Knowing how to plan accessible upgrades means treating access as a connected user journey, not a checklist of isolated building elements.

For existing buildings, the right response is rarely a single product or standard detail. It requires a clear understanding of the building, its users, the proposed works and the regulatory pathway. Early specialist advice creates room to resolve competing requirements before they become expensive site constraints.

Start with the reason for the upgrade

Accessible upgrades may be prompted by a refurbishment, a change in use, a tenant requirement, an access complaint, an ageing asset, a planning condition or an organisational commitment to inclusion. Each trigger affects the scope of assessment and the level of intervention required.

The first task is to define what is changing. A modest internal fitout can have consequences for paths of travel, door circulation, sanitary facilities, wayfinding and emergency procedures. A new entrance may affect gradients, drainage, kerb crossings, parking and the relationship between the footpath and the building threshold. For a public-facing venue, the experience of arriving, entering, finding services and leaving should be considered as one continuous sequence.

In Australia, relevant obligations may arise through the National Construction Code (NCC), the Disability (Access to Premises - Buildings) Standards 2010, the Disability Discrimination Act 1992, planning requirements and other sector-specific rules. The applicable provisions depend on the building classification, nature of work, approval pathway and jurisdiction. Australian Standards, including the relevant parts of AS 1428, provide critical technical detail, but the correct edition and extent of application must be confirmed for the project.

Compliance is a necessary baseline, not a substitute for careful design. A technically compliant outcome may still be difficult to use if it overlooks actual operations, furniture layouts, queuing, lighting, acoustics or maintenance practices.

How to plan accessible upgrades from an evidence base

Before setting a budget or selecting solutions, establish accurate existing-condition information. This usually begins with an access audit or targeted site assessment that records dimensions, levels, door forces, circulation widths, thresholds, fixtures, signage, lighting conditions and obstructions. Photographs and measured plans are useful, but they should not replace a detailed on-site review where complex interfaces are involved.

The assessment should also examine how people use the place. A school has different peak movement patterns from an aged care facility. A medical practice may need to consider reception privacy, transfer space and accessible examination rooms. In multi-storey commercial buildings, the lift, entry sequence and end-of-trip facilities may be more significant than any one internal doorway.

Operational teams often identify issues that drawings do not reveal. Ask who receives deliveries, where visitors wait, whether doors are routinely held open, how rubbish bins are stored and what happens when a lift is out of service. Consultation with people with disability and representative user groups can add valuable insight, particularly where a facility serves a defined community.

Prioritise the complete path of travel

The most effective upgrades address the route a person takes from arrival to the services they need. Beginning at the property boundary or parking area, consider parking, drop-off points, footpaths, ramps, entrances, reception, lifts, corridors, amenities, meeting rooms and exits. A break anywhere along that route can make the rest of the investment ineffective.

This approach helps project teams avoid a common retrofit error: upgrading the most visible element while leaving the critical barrier untouched. For example, providing an accessible entry is of limited value if the intercom is out of reach, the security gate is too narrow, or the reception desk does not offer a usable transaction point. Similarly, an accessible sanitary compartment needs an approach route, compliant circulation, correctly positioned fittings and adequate ongoing maintenance.

Prioritisation should reflect both risk and use. High-traffic public areas, essential services and locations where a person has no reasonable alternative route generally warrant early attention. Less frequently used spaces may be staged, provided the overall strategy is clear and temporary arrangements do not create new barriers.

Turn technical requirements into buildable details

Accessibility succeeds or fails in the details. A small level change can affect ramp length, landings, handrails, drainage and adjacent door clearances. Widening a door may require changes to framing, hardware, fire ratings and access control. Adding tactile ground surface indicators without considering the required application, surrounding finishes and pedestrian movement can create confusion rather than useful wayfinding.

Design documentation needs to show more than a general note stating that work is to comply with access requirements. Plans, sections, schedules and specifications should communicate dimensions, set-downs, gradients, circulation spaces, fixture locations, hardware, luminance contrast where relevant and installation tolerances. Builders need coordinated information that can be set out and constructed without relying on interpretation at site level.

This is where architectural and access expertise should work together. An access consultant can identify the technical requirements and risk points; an architect can integrate them with structure, services, waterproofing, heritage fabric and the intended character of the space. The result should be practical to build, maintain and use, rather than a late amendment that compromises the design.

Where an existing building cannot readily accommodate a deemed-to-satisfy solution, do not assume that a reduced outcome is acceptable. A performance solution may be available in some circumstances, but it must be based on sound evidence, clearly documented and assessed through the appropriate process. It is not a shortcut for poor planning.

Budget for interfaces, not just visible items

A realistic budget recognises that accessible upgrades often involve enabling works. Installing a ramp may require excavation, stormwater changes, retaining, new balustrades and alterations to the entry door. An accessible bathroom may require plumbing relocation, wall reinforcement, waterproofing, ventilation and electrical changes. In older buildings, concealed conditions can add further uncertainty.

Allow a contingency that reflects the quality of available site information and the age of the asset. It is usually more cost-effective to investigate structure, services and levels before tender than to resolve them through variations during construction. Staging can also be sensible for large portfolios, but each stage should preserve a coherent accessible route and avoid spending money twice.

Construction programming matters as much as capital cost. If an entrance, lift or amenity is temporarily unavailable, plan an alternative that is dignified, safe and clearly communicated. Temporary access arrangements should be reviewed with the same care as permanent works, especially in health, education, aged care and public facilities where users may have limited options.

Review at design, site and handover stages

An access review is most valuable when undertaken before key decisions are locked in. Engage specialist input at concept design to test feasibility, at developed design to coordinate critical dimensions, and before construction issue to check documentation. Site inspections during construction can identify deviations before finishes, hardware and fixtures are fixed in place.

At handover, verify that the built outcome matches the approved detail. Check door operation, gradients, clearances, signage, controls, accessible sanitary facilities and the continuity of the path of travel. Equally, confirm that facilities management teams understand how features are intended to operate. An accessible counter ceases to function if it becomes a storage surface, and a clear corridor loses value when furniture is allowed to encroach.

For complex assets, maintain a record of the assessment, design decisions, performance solution evidence where applicable, inspection findings and outstanding actions. This supports future refurbishments, asset management and a more defensible response if questions arise about access provision.

Plan for constraints without lowering ambition

Heritage buildings, tight urban sites, steep land and occupied facilities can make accessible upgrades challenging. These constraints require a tailored strategy, not a generic detail imposed regardless of context. Sometimes the best answer is a reconfigured entry sequence, a relocated service point, a carefully integrated platform lift or targeted improvements that provide an equivalent level of amenity through another route.

The objective is to remove barriers in a way that is equitable, compliant and commercially credible.
